Mediterranean Salad with Za'atar Spice

Ingredients:
- 4 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 red pepper, thinly sliced
- 1 green pepper, thinly sliced
- 1 yellow pepper, thinly sliced
- 1 (400 g) can chickpeas, drained
- 1 (400 g) can artichoke hearts, drained
- 1 small avocado, peeled and sliced
- 6 sun-dried tomatoes packed in oil, drained and chopped
- 2 tablespoons Za'atar Spice
- 4 tablespoons chopped parsley
- 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
- salt and pepper, to taste
Instructions:
- Put half the olive oil in a frying pan and sauté the sliced peppers for 3-5 minutes until the skins start to blister and the peppers soften.
- Take off the heat and leave to cool slightly for a few minutes.
- Meanwhile, put the chickpeas, artichoke hearts, avocado and tomatoes in a large bowl.
- When the peppers have cooled slightly, add them to the other ingredients in the bowl.
- Sprinkle over the Zaatar seasoning, or make a reasonable substitute by combining thyme, marjoram, and sesame seeds with a bit of salt.
- Make the dressing by mixing up the other half of the olive oil and balsamic vinegar.
- Pour the dressing over the salad and mix well.
- Season with salt and pepper and sprinkle with the parsley.
- Serve either at room temperature or chilled..
Notes
-
If you are making this ahead of time, leave out the avocados until just before serving or they will discolor.
- You can also spice up this salad by using a chilli-infused olive oil.
